How much do event planner trainee j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 16, 2026, the average hourly pay for event planner trainee in the United States is $30.45,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$24.04 and $35.34 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How to gain experience as an event planner trainee?

To gain experience as an event planner trainee, seek internships or entry-level positions that offer hands-on involvement in event coordination. Developing skills in organization, communication, and familiarity with event management tools like project planning software can enhance your qualifications. Volunteering for local events or assisting experienced planners also provides practical experience and networking opportunities.

Is there a demand for event planner trainees?

There is steady demand for event planner trainees as the events industry continues to grow, requiring entry-level staff to assist with planning and coordination. Trainees often gain skills in organization, communication, and event management tools, which can lead to full-time positions in the field.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an event planner trainee, and why are they important?

To excel as an Event Planner Trainee,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and a basic understanding of event planning concepts, often supported by a relevant degree or coursework. Familiarity with event management software, budgeting tools, and scheduling systems is typically required. Excellent communication, adaptability, and problem-solving abilities help you work effectively with clients, vendors, and teams. These skills ensure smooth event execution, client satisfaction, and successful coordination in a dynamic environment.

How do you become an event planner trainee?

To become an event planner trainee, candidates typically need a high school diploma or equivalent and should develop skills in organization, communication, and time management. Gaining experience through internships or entry-level positions in event planning or hospitality can also help, and some may pursue certifications like the Certified Meeting Professional (CMP) to enhance their qualifications.

What is an event planner trainee?

Event Planner Trainees are entry-level professionals who assist experienced event planners in organizing and coordinating various types of events, such as corporate meetings, weddings, and conferences. Their responsibilities typically include helping with venue selection, managing vendor communications, assisting with event logistics, and supporting on-site event execution. This role is designed to provide hands-on training and experience in the event planning industry, helping trainees develop the skills needed to advance to more senior event planning positions.

What are some common challenges faced by event planner trainees during their first year, and how can they overcome them?

Event Planner Trainees often encounter challenges such as managing tight deadlines, handling last-minute changes, and coordinating with multiple vendors. It can also be overwhelming to balance client expectations while staying within budget and logistical limits. To overcome these hurdles, it's helpful to develop strong organizational skills, maintain clear communication with all parties, and seek guidance from experienced team members. Embracing flexibility and learning from each event will help you build confidence and proficiency in your role.

What is the difference between Event Planner Trainee vs Event Coordinator?

AspectEvent Planner TraineeEvent Coordinator
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may prefer coursework in event planning or hospitalityHigh school diploma; some roles may require certification or experience in event management
Work EnvironmentTraining settings, assisting experienced planners, often in office or event venuesActive involvement in planning, coordinating, and executing events, often on-site at event locations
Employer & Industry UsageInternships, entry-level positions in event planning companies, hotels, or venuesFull-time roles in event planning companies, corporate events, weddings, and conferences

The main difference is that an Event Planner Trainee is in a learning or apprenticeship phase, gaining skills under supervision, while an Event Coordinator is a more experienced professional responsible for managing and executing events independently.
